dogstile posted:

The average k/d is under 1 because if 60 players are in a game only 59 of them can get kills and because it also skews top end.

Maths eh?

Skewing top end won't affect the mean, which is usually what people mean when they just say "average". And if you put 60 players into a deathmatch game with no respawning, yes only 59 kills are possible. But only 59 will die so it's exactly 1 k/d.

The real reason the mean K/D is below 1 is because of suicides. You can't get a kill without also causing a death, but you CAN die without allowing a kill.

repiv posted:

Does Japan require them to do that for legal reasons, or are they just using Japan to test the waters?

Apparently Bethesda did the exact same thing a few years ago in Japan:
https://www.reddit.com/r/RAGEgame/comments/c6ielb/bethesda_puts_an_expiration_date_on_virtual/

Someone on there speculated it was related to this:

quote:

I did however found that companies can be excluded from being subjected to the law called payment services act IF they set an expiration date to be less than 6 months AND specify that date.

It seems setting an expiration date to virtual currency is a not so uncommon way to avoid legal regulations -.-

If anyone's interested here's a link to the English translation of the law mentioned above.

http://www.japaneselawtranslation.go.jp/law/detail/?id=3078&vm=04&re=01

Curiously it was also pointed out that EA had similar language in their TOS back then. I guess they just haven't done it in a game until now.
